This post is about a shrimp dish 🍤. The star of this menu is shrimp, which has a sweet and delicious taste because of its freshness. I must say that one of the highlights of Phra Nakhon Si Ayutthaya province is definitely the giant freshwater prawns 🦐.
Since Ayutthaya is located in the central region where many important rivers converge 🌊, it has become a fertile water source full of minerals. This makes the freshwater prawns here not only tasty and firm but also reasonably priced because they come directly from the source.

Alright then, let’s start with the steps to make Shrimp in Red Curry Sauce 🦐🍛!
The ingredients are as follows:


- 🦐 Shrimp – 16 pieces (Shells on or off as you prefer)
- 🍯 Coconut palm sugar – 1 tbsp
- 🌶️ Red curry paste – 2 tbsp
- 🥥 Coconut milk – 250 ml (about 1 cup)
- 🧂 Fish sauce – 1 tbsp
- 🧂 Salt – ½ tsp
- 🌶️ Red chili – 2 pieces (sliced thin for garnish)
- 🍃 Kaffir lime leaves – 4 leaves (thinly sliced)


Step 1 : I will wash the shrimp thoroughly and peel the shells off the body. Then, I will trim the tips of the heads but keep the shrimp heads on, because that’s where the delicious creamy fat is. 🦐✨


Step 2 : After that, I will thinly slice the kaffir lime leaves 🍃 to bring out their fragrance. I will also slice the red chili 🌶️, but remove the seeds to avoid extra spiciness, since the red curry paste already gives enough heat. The chili is mainly added for a touch of color ✨.


Step 3 : Once all the ingredients are ready, it’s time to start cooking! 👩🍳 First, I pour the coconut milk 🥥 into a pan over low heat, then add the red curry paste 🌶️. Stir and let them simmer together for a while until well combined. ✨




Step 4 : Season with coconut palm sugar 🍯, salt 🧂, and fish sauce 🧂. Stir well and let everything blend together nicely. ✨ This step fills the kitchen with a wonderful, fragrant aroma 🌿


Step 5 : Add the shrimp 🦐 to the pan and stir-fry until they turn a golden color ✨.


Step 6 : Add the sliced kaffir lime leaves 🍃 and red chili 🌶️ to enhance the fragrance and add beautiful color. Stir everything together for about 30 seconds, and it’s done! ✨

And here is the final look of the Shrimp in Red Curry Sauce 🍤🍛, with a perfect balance of sweet, salty, and creamy flavors. It goes perfectly with warm steamed rice 🍚—absolutely delicious! 😋 I hope my post will be helpful and inspiring for all of you. ✨
